Davine Gerian: A Stylish Sans Serif Font for Modern Brand Campaigns

Davine Gerian for Instagram Posts and Social Media Graphics

When designing a new Instagram content series for a lifestyle brand, I needed a font that could stand out in a fast-scrolling feed while maintaining a clean, modern aesthetic. Davine Gerian, a stylish sans-serif font, immediately caught my eye. Its letterforms are refined yet distinctive, making it ideal for headlines, quote graphics, and campaign tags. I used it for a set of promotional posts announcing a seasonal product drop. The font’s high-contrast strokes and slightly condensed structure gave the visuals a boutique feel without sacrificing readability. On mobile previews, the text remained crisp and legible, even with light overlays on image backgrounds.

How Davine Gerian Performs in YouTube Thumbnails and Reels Covers

Thumbnail design is all about grabbing attention in just a few pixels. For a creator’s YouTube launch campaign, I tested Davine Gerian against several other modern fonts. What stood out was its balance between uniqueness and clarity. When used for short phrases like “New Video” or “Behind the Scenes,” Davine Gerian held up well even in small sizes. The font’s open spacing and clean lines helped avoid the “crowded thumbnail” effect that can turn viewers away. It worked especially well against dark backgrounds, where its subtle stroke contrast became more pronounced. This makes it a strong choice for creators who want a premium, curated look without overcomplicating their visuals.

Davine Gerian for Wedding Invitations and Elegant Branding

I recently worked on a brand identity project for a boutique wedding planner, and Davine Gerian became a core part of the typographic system. The font’s elegant structure and modern sans-serif style gave the brand a contemporary yet refined edge. I used it across invitation templates, social media headers, and email banners. It performed especially well in logo-style text and decorative titles. The font’s alternate characters added a personalized touch to custom designs, making each piece feel handcrafted. When paired with a simple serif font for body text, the visual hierarchy was clear and visually appealing, enhancing both readability and brand recognition.

Using Davine Gerian in Digital Ads and Email Banners

In a recent email campaign for a wellness brand, I tested Davine Gerian in subject line banners and callout text. The goal was to create a sense of exclusivity and premium quality. The font delivered. On both desktop and mobile email clients, the text was easy to scan and visually engaging. I found it worked best as a display font—perfect for headlines, promotional labels, and feature highlights. However, I avoided using it for long paragraphs or detailed descriptions, where a cleaner, more neutral sans-serif was better suited. For digital ads, I used it sparingly in hero banners and campaign tags, where its modern style helped elevate the overall design without overwhelming the message.

Font Pairing and Design Compatibility with Davine Gerian

One of the strengths of Davine Gerian is how well it pairs with other typefaces. As a modern sans-serif font, it works beautifully with minimalist serif fonts for a balanced, editorial-style layout. I’ve also paired it with clean script fonts for event branding, where the contrast between styles added visual interest without clashing. For digital content like landing pages or branded templates, I recommend using Davine Gerian for primary headlines and a simpler font like Helvetica or Roboto for supporting text. This helps maintain readability while still leveraging the font’s creative appeal. It’s also worth checking the included styles, ligatures, and alternates—these can add a custom touch to logos, packaging design, and editorial graphics.
